Dry Pot Farmhouse Stir-Fried PorkDry pot farmhouse stir-fried pork is a Chinese dish made with pork and ingredients such as green peppers, red peppers, and garlic, stir-fried quickly in hot oil. It is characterized by its fresh aroma, tender meat, and rich flavor.
New-style Pepper Stir-fried PorkNew-style chili stir-fried pork is a Chinese home-style dish using pork and chili as main ingredients. Pork, usually belly or lean meat, is sliced thin or julienned; chili, often green or red pepper, is cut into segments. First, pork is stir-fried to release oil, then chilies are added and cooked together. Seasoning completes the dish. Simple and quick to prepare, it emphasizes natural flavors and texture harmony.
Sichuan Boiled BeefSichuan-style boiled beef is a dish made primarily with beef, paired with vegetables such as bean sprouts and cabbage, prepared by high-heat stir-frying followed by boiling. Thinly sliced beef is first stir-fried at high heat to lock in its juices, then simmered with broth and vegetables until tender, preserving the beef's fresh and tender texture.

Carbon Pot Fish (Qingjiang Fish)Carbon pot fish (Qingjiang fish) is a dish made with Qingjiang fish, cooked over charcoal. The fish meat is tender, and it is combined with seasonings and side dishes for a rich flavor.
Braised Yellow River CarpA traditional Chinese dish made by braising a Yellow River carp with soy sauce, sugar, and aromatics, resulting in tender fish and rich, glossy sauce.
Shrimp Dried and Chrysanthemum GreensA simple dish made with fresh chrysanthemum greens and dried shrimp, stir-fried for a savory, healthy meal.
Stewed Deer Mushroom in PotA dish featuring deer mushrooms stewed with chicken and ham in a small pot, resulting in a rich, savory flavor.
Spicy Pig's Trotter CubesSpicy pig's trotter cubes stir-fried with chili and Sichuan pepper, offering a crunchy texture and bold spicy flavor.
Spicy Noodles with Boiled ChickenSpicy noodles with boiled chicken is a Chinese dish made with noodles, boiled chicken, and spicy seasonings. Main ingredients include noodles, chicken, chili, and Sichuan peppercorns, with a spicy and fragrant flavor.
